The solutions are provided for each question, along with an explanation, so that the student will be able to pinpoint exactly where any errors may have been made.These questions pertain to … WebConcept of Double Entry. 2 minutes of reading. Every transaction has two effects. For example, if someone transacts a purchase of a drink from a local store, he pays cash to the shopkeeper and in return, he gets a bottle of dink. This simple transaction has two effects from the perspective of both, the buyer as well as the seller. facts money

WebJan 10, 2024 · Its focus was the accounting practice and the management of a small charitable hospice within the context of its socio-political, economic, and commercial environment. Identification of this hybrid variant form of double entry bookkeeping in the account book of the charity confirms that diffusion of the method had occurred.
